WebFeb 16, 2024 · To calculate the blank cells in row 5 for our dataset, the code is: Sub CountBlankWithCountBlankRow () MsgBox WorksheetFunction.CountBlank (Range ("B5:F5")) End Sub. This piece of code will count the blank cells for the row of range B5:F5. Now, Run the macro.
